DLS Webinar Wednesday: Asynchronous Instruction using HyperDocs
HyperDocs are an excellent, easy to create type of instruction module. All you need is a Google Drive account and a lesson plan! The Doc serves as a central landing point for students, giving them different tasks to complete on their own time and at their own pace. HyperDocs are extremely popular among K-12 teachers but can be easily tweaked to fit the needs of librarians and students/patrons in a variety of settings!
